3 Types Of Sports Injuries A Chiropractor Can Assist With
As an athlete, as much as you try to avoid a sports injury, sometimes they happen. When you suffer a sports injury, you need a team of medical experts to help you get better. A chiropractor is one of the many professionals who can assist you and help you recover from a sports injury. Chiropractors can help with many injury types, including the following.
A Neck Injury
When you play a contact sport, there is always a chance that you can injure your neck. Maybe you took a hard hit in football and experienced whiplash, or perhaps you fell while doing a cheerleading stunt. If you injured your neck, a chiropractor can be a great resource for helping you treat the pain.
A chiropractor can use gentle readjustment strategies overtime to help get your neck back in proper realignment. A chiropractor can also use a variety of different massage techniques in order to relax your neck muscles and help your neck feel better over time.
A neck injury can also create other issues as well, such as pain in your lower back as well. A chiropractor can help you deal with any other resulting pain.
A Pinched Nerve
Another common sports injury is a pinched nerve. A pinched nerve, under any circumstance, can be really painful. It can be even more painful when you can't just relax, and you are expected to move around and perform.
A chiropractor can be part of your team that helps you with a pinched nerve. A chiropractor can use spinal adjustment techniques to help reduce the pressure on your pinched nerve. They can also use a variety of massage techniques to help reduce the tension in your back and get you on a path to healing and playing again as quickly as possible.
A Back Injury
Back injuries can be caused by so many things, including sports. If you hurt your back, one of the first people you should turn to is a chiropractor. A chiropractor is an expert at taking care of your back. They will help adjust your spine, which can help get rid of your pain. They will use a variety of different techniques, such as a rolling bed, heat therapy, and various massage techniques to help get you back in shape.
When it comes to taking care of sports injuries, one of the professionals you should have on your team is a chiropractor. A chiropractor can help with sports injuries related to your neck and back, as well as more specific injuries, such as a pinched nerve.
